Most plug-in vehicle models come equipped with a Level-1 charger station. This allows you to charge your car from any 110-volt household outlet. This charging station can provide a range of 2-5 miles per hour and is the most affordable way to charge your electric vehicle. You may consider investing in a Level-2 charging station if you drive long distances. These chargers provide faster charging times and can be placed in your garage or at home.

You can install a wallbox charger if your home doesn't have a charging station. These chargers can be wired to your home's electrical supply and will charge your car much faster than a regular wall outlet. Before purchasing a charging device, you might need to have it checked by an electrician.
